Navistar, Inc. is recalling certain 2023 IC CE, EV
— Recall Campaign #22V870000
Navistar, Inc. (Navistar) is recalling certain 2023 IC CE, EV, and RE vehicles. The hex flange lock nuts, used in the suspension and steering joints, were improperly heat treated and may lose tension over time.
The recall was influenced by the manufacturer with about 5,645 units affected.

- Description:
- Navistar, Inc. (Navistar) is recalling certain 2023 IC CE, EV, and RE vehicles. The hex flange lock nuts, used in the suspension and steering joints, were improperly heat treated and may lose tension over time.
- Consequeces:
- A loss of tension in the steering and suspension joints may lead to steering instability and increase the risk of a crash.
- Corrective action:
- Dealers will replace the hex flange lock nuts as necessary, free of charge. Owner notification letters are expected to be mailed January 20, 2023. Owners may contact Navistar's customer service at 1-800-448-7825. Navistar's number for this recall is 22525.
